Output 06ab2af59e762898ce8610c188a7129a82dfb2489aa39e808760f7bb49818bb8:0

value
25263558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b21a3df9ad1850ec387b90addbdcab415a3d108 OP_EQUAL
address
MDHpQ74xBnKQJx1wr3XPLytF2qtN4fRUSH
transaction
06ab2af59e762898ce8610c188a7129a82dfb2489aa39e808760f7bb49818bb8
spent
true